Unlike slot machines or roulette, blackjack allows players to make choices that influence the outcome. Each decision—whether to hit, stand, split, or double down—can increase or decrease your chances of winning. That’s why even basic strategy is crucial for beginners.
By learning when to act (and when not to), you lower the house edge to as little as 0.5%—far better than most casino games.
To use strategy properly, you need to understand the rules:
Your goal is to beat the dealer’s hand without going over 21.
Number cards are worth their face value.
Face cards are worth 10.
Aces are worth 1 or 11, depending on your hand.
You can:
Hit to get another card
Stand to keep your hand
Double down to double your bet and receive one more card
Split if you have a pair
If your hand is 12–16, and the dealer has a 7 or higher, hit.
If the dealer shows 2–6, stand on 12 or more.
Always hit on 11 or less, unless doubling is a better option.

1. How do I know when to hit or stand in blackjack?
Use a basic strategy chart that tells you the optimal move based on your total and the dealer’s visible card. It’s the smartest guide for beginners.
2. Is blackjack easier to win than other casino games?
Yes, blackjack has one of the lowest house edges when played correctly. That’s why learning a strategy gives you an advantage over games like roulette or slots.
3. What’s the worst hand in blackjack?
A hard 16 (like a 10 + 6) is considered one of the worst starting hands. That’s why knowing when to hit or stand in these tough spots is essential.
4. Can I use blackjack strategy at live tables?
Absolutely. Whether online or in a real casino, strategy applies the same way. Just stay focused and avoid distractions.
